2013-10-22 36 views
0

我不確定這是否可行。我有這樣的頁面設置:在其實際位置後顯示div

<div class="sidebar"> 
</div> 
<div class="main"> 
</div> 

側邊欄設置爲float:right。除了調整窗口大小(因爲它的響應速度)之外,它還沒有問題,側欄出現以上的內容爲。它設置爲position:static並且沒有浮動。

在響應模式下,是否可以讓側欄出現在「main」div之後 - 僅通過CSS?我想不出使用僞元素來做到這一點的方法。

PS:我無法將.sidebar div放在HTML中的.main div下面,因爲Google決定不要這樣做。顯示我的作者頭像,因爲它是「不相關的」,即太低而忽略它。

+1

主要div後的含義是什麼?這可以通過幾種方式查看,給我們一個鏈接到一個頁面或一個例子,描述你想要達到的效果,如果可能的話。 – SidOfc

回答

0

谷歌顯示你的頭像不是它下降多遠的結果。谷歌查找此位的html:

rel=author 

看到這篇文章:http://searchengineland.com/googleplus-slowly-invading-googles-main-search-results-102416

一旦你這樣做,你可以切換到HTML的順序有「主」,再浮動「主」和「邊欄」留在適當的斷點處。

+0

對不起,但那不是事實。網站站長工具中有一條消息,指出「Google已決定這些信息不相關」。一旦您將其移動到頁面上,該消息就會消失,豐富的代碼片段也能正常工作。 – toadly

相關問題